Benefits, Where to Place & How to Use

Benefits

Worshipping Lord Krishna is believed to invite love, harmony, prosperity and positive energy into the home. Bala Krishna, in particular, is associated with joy, childlike innocence, protection of children and the removal of obstacles and negativity. Keeping his idol in a living space is said to fill it with peace, devotion and auspicious vibrations, while the sound of his flute symbolizes the divine call that draws the soul toward love and wisdom. As a durable brass heirloom, it also carries lasting sentimental and spiritual value that can be passed down through generations.

Where to Place (as per Vastu tradition)

  • Place the idol in the north-east (Ishanya) corner of your home or pooja room, the direction traditionally reserved for worship.
  • Ensure Krishna faces west or east, with the devotee facing the deity while praying.
  • Keep it on a clean, slightly raised platform or altar, never directly on the floor.
  • In the living room, position it on a console or shelf at or above eye level, away from clutter, footwear and the bathroom wall.
  • For the workplace, a clean desk or reception shelf works well to invite positive energy.

How to Use / Care

  • Begin worship by cleaning the idol and the altar; light a diya or incense and offer fresh flowers, tulsi leaves, and prasad such as butter, milk or sweets — favourites of Makhan Chor Krishna.
  • Recite Krishna mantras such as "Om Namo Bhagavate Vasudevaya" or the Hare Krishna maha-mantra during prayer.
  • To clean the brass, gently wipe with a soft dry cloth. For a deeper shine, use a mild tamarind or lemon-and-salt paste or a dedicated brass cleaner, then rinse and dry thoroughly.
  • Avoid harsh abrasives; a natural patina over time is normal and often cherished as a sign of an authentic brass idol.
